Arachnolithulus pygmaeus
Taxonomy
Arachnolithulus pygmaeus was named by Wunderlich (1988). It is an inclusion in amber. Its type locality is Dominican amber (Wunderlich collection), which is in a Burdigalian/Langhian terrestrial amber in the Dominican Republic. It is the type species of Arachnolithulus.
